Industrial Tips: Right Roots Blower for Foundation Pit Ventilation

Industrial Tips: Right Roots Blower for Foundation Pit Ventilation

2026-03-24

In the construction industry, foundation pit ventilation is a critical safety measure that directly protects the lives of construction workers and ensures the smooth progress of projects. Deep foundation pits, especially those in urban areas or with complex geological conditions, are prone to accumulate toxic and harmful gases such as methane, hydrogen sulfide, and carbon monoxide, which are released from soil layers or construction materials. In addition, poor ventilation can lead to insufficient oxygen levels, causing workers to suffer from hypoxia, dizziness, or even fatal accidents. As the core equipment of foundation pit ventilation systems, Roots blowers are responsible for delivering fresh air into the pit and discharging harmful gases, making their selection and application crucial to construction safety.
